A $60M lawsuit has been filed against the Nassau police for an alleged wrongful arrest at a legislative hearing in 2024.
Maria Campanelli, 27, suffered a traumatic brain injury, bruising, and emotional distress after being "manhandled" by officers at the Aug. 5, 2024, meeting in Mineola.
Police officers assaulted and arrested the wrong suspect while responding to a report of an unruly person at a Nassau County legislature hearing on the Mask Transparency Act last year.
The lawsuit, filed in federal court in Central Islip, argues that Campanelli was the victim of wrongful arrest and seeks $60 million in damages.
